Draws Dominate CAF Champions League Second Round
Defending champion Al Ahly has been held to a fortunate goalless draw by CA Bizerte in their CAF Champions League second round, first-leg encounter in Tunisia on Sunday.
The Egyptians have goalkeeper Sherif Ekrami to thank for the draw after he made a number of fine saves. Bizerte star Larbi Jabeur also had a goal disallowed for a foul on the keeper.
Esperance, who have made the last three Champions League finals, winning in 2011, were also held scoreless by Algerian side JSM Bejaia.
The Tunisians were unfortunate not to get an away goal though as Youcef Belaïli hit the crossbar early on, and when he did have the ball in the back of the net it was ruled out for offside.
Zamalek have it all to do after they could only manage a 1-1 home draw with Ethiopian side St George. Umed Ukuri put the visitors ahead in Cairo, before Abdoulaye Cissé equalised for the White Knights with seven minutes remaining.
Cameroon side CotonSport were in rampant form as they beat Stade Malien 3-0 and might have won by an even greater margin after missing a host of chances.
Promising rising star Yougouda Kada had the home team ahead and the midfielder added a second before halftime. Striker Ismaël Bang made the scoreline more emphatic with 12 minutes to go.
Cote d’Ivoire’s Sewe Sports hold the upper hand after they drew 1-1 with FUS Rabat in Morocco. The host went ahead with 20 minutes to play through Brahim El Bahri, but Kévin Zougoula equalised 10 minutes later for what could be a vital away goal.
Nigeria’s Enugu Rangers were held to a 0-0 draw at home by Recreativo Libolo of Angola, while Congo champions AC Leopards won 3-1 at home to Algerian side Entente Setif.
Orlando Pirates collected perhaps the win of the round of matches though as they beat much-vaunted TP Mazembe 3-1, boosted by a dubious late penalty award that was converted by Collins Mbesuma. The Zambian forward and Nigerian star Onyekachi Okonkwo got the other goals, while Patou Kabangu netted for the Congolese.
The return legs are on the weekend of May 3-5, while the winners qualify for the group phase of the Champions League starting in July and the losers drop down to the African Confederation Cup.
